Traditional South African Malva Pudding Recipe

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 40 minutes
  • Total Time: 55 minutes
  • Yield: 6 to 8 servings

Ingredients

Scale

For the Pudding:

  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tablespoon apricot jam
  • 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on unsalted butter, melted
  • 1 teaspoon white vinegar
  • 1/2 cup whole milk

For the Sauce:

  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 6 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/3 cup hot water
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ract


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ven and prepare the baking dish: Preheat the oven to 350°F and grease a 9×9-inch baking dish.
  2. Mix the pudding batter: Beat sugar and eggs, add apricot jam, then mix dry ingredients separately and combine with milk mixture. Pour into the baking dish.
  3. Bake the pudding: Bake for 35-40 minutes until golden and a toothpick comes out clean.
  4. Prepare the sauce: Combine cream, butter, sugar, water, and vanilla in a saucepan, heat gently until sugar is dissolved.
  5. Serve: Pour the warm sauce over the hot pudding, let it soak, then serve warm with custard, whipped cream, or ice cream.

Notes

  • Malva pudding is best served warm and fresh for optimal enjoyment.
  • Reheats well if made ahead, ensuring a delicious treat even the next day.
  • Apricot jam adds a distinctive flavor to the pudding, enhancing its traditional taste.
